  • feeling blue
  • (It happened) out of the blue
  • between the devil and the deep blue sea
  • talk 'til I'm blue in the face
  • talk a blue streak
  • once in a blue moon
  • flash those baby blues
  • all black and blue
  • a black mark on one's reputation
  • the black sheep of the family
  • buy on the black market
  • (things aren't always) black and white
  • in the black (meaning out of debt)
  • the pot calling the kettle black
  • a black tie affair
  • Let's brown bag it. (bring a lunch from home)
  • in the red (in debt)
  • (it's a gray area)
  • pretty in pink
  • red hot
  • a red letter day
  • roll out the red carpet, get the red carpet treatment
  • white hot
  • to whitewash something
  • green with envy
  • have a green thumb
  • the grass is always greener
  • green around the edges
  • give someone the green light (meaning permission)
  • He's green. (having little or no experience with something)
  • Every cloud has a silver lining.
  • go for the gold
  • a golden opportunity
  • all that glitters is not gold
  • the goose that laid the golden egg
  • in the pink
  • red as a beet
